I think my problem now goes beyond the cat.
Not only can I not get the bolts out of the flanges, but I can now hear
rattling in the muffler, and the connecting pipe between the cat and the
muffler.
I believe the honeycomb has gotten all over inside the exhaust.
These flange bolts are drivng me crazy. They aren't copper, as expected.
They are some kind of hardened metal. I broke two drill bits (cobalt bits
none-the-less) and went through three fiberglass reinforced cut-off discs
on a rotary cutter.
I eventually cut the nuts and bolt-heads off, but I still can't drill
through, or punch out the bolt shaft from the cat. flanges.
